What is CVE-2025-62900?
The Popular Posts by Webline pl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to a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) issue due to improper input neutralization during web page generation. This vulnerability allows attackers to inject malicious scripts into web pages viewed by other users, which may lead to session hijacking, defacement, or redirection to malicious sites. Users of versions 1.1.1 and earlier are advised to update to a fixed version to mitigate the risks associated with this vulnerability.
